Aucbvax.6128 net.bugs.2bsd utcsrgv!utzoo!decvax!ucbvax!randvax!sdcnet!dgc Mon Feb 8 23:23:45 1982 job control code and issig messages From: Dave Clemans Locally, I have used the "job control" code from 2.8bsd, along with header file mods from 4.1bsd to implement a system with 32 signals and the "hold" option (value=3) to the standard signal system call. It seems to work find, except that under moderate to heavy load conditions, the "issig" warning message in issig(sig.c) is printed. (i.e., issig is complaining that it found an ignored or held signal past the point in the code where a check for those types of signals are made and an early exit taken from the routine). We also have gotten the message on rare occassions on our vax running 4.1. (the vax system is straight 4.1 except for supporting RP04's and the Versatec V80 plotter) Has anyone (particularly anyone associated with developing the job control code) seen this situation before?
